Arrow Norrathmap.com is looking for beta testers

NorrathMap is an EQ mapping app that lets you see your location within a zone. It is easy to setup, configure, maintain and use. Alpha phase (invite only registration) is over, and Beta phase has started. We'd love for you to give NorrathMap a try. You can get registered and download it here.
